    The Armenia School Foundation (ASF) Raises over $100,000 at the 5th
    Anniversary Gala Celebration

    Glendale, California, June 23, 2008 - The Armenia School Foundation (ASF
    USA), a non-profit organization dedicated to refurnishing schools in
    Armenia and Karabagh, hosted a gala banquet on May 31 to celebrate its 5th
    Anniversary, at Homenetmen Ararat Center.

    The evening marked the second annual banquet for ASF since its inception
    in May 2003. `ASF's 2008 goal is to furnish 12 new schools in regions of
    Armavir, Aragatsotn, and Karabagh'said Armen Abrahamian, chairman of the
    Board. `Tonight, with the support and generous donations from friends and
    community members, we were able to raise more than $100,000 in donations
    and raffle sales, which will be allocated for the refurnishing of the new
    schools.'

    The gala was attended by 250 friends, supporters, representatives of
    media and community organizations as well as public figures such as Armen
    Liloyan, Council General of the Republic of Armenia in LA, California
    Assemblyman Paul Krekorian, Former Glendale Mayors Ara Najarian, Steve
    Artinian, Chairman of the Homenetmen Western US Region, and Dr. Alina
    Dorian who delivered the welcoming remarks.

    The Armenia School Foundation (ASF USA) is a non profit organization,
    founded in May 2003. ASF USA strives to provide new furniture for remote
    schools in various regions of Armenia and Karabagh to enhance the learning
    environment. ASF has provided over 8,000 sets of furnishings to-date to
    over 180 schools with funds collected worldwide. For more information
